Speech Pathologist The Speech Pathologist evaluates, plans, and administers medically prescribed speech and language therapy treatment to clients. The Speech Pathologist diagnoses and treats speech, language, voice and swallowing disorders. This position implements care plan through the use of evidenced based modalities and skilled interventions to increase patients' ability to achieve mutually established functional goals. This position coordinates clinical test results with other diagnostic data, provides prognosis, develops treatment plan, and provides patient and family education. Responsibilities
Completes evaluations of assigned patients/clients in accordance with established standards of care and practice. Plans and provides treatment to assigned patient/client's as appropriate in accordance with established standards of care and practice. Coordinates client care with other clinical team members ensuring optimal client care and communication as noted in the clinical record. Completes all required documentation per department standards. Maintains knowledge/license and certification. After one year of experience, may act as student supervisor.

About Us Baptist Health Care is a not-for-profit health care system committed to improving the quality of life for people and communities in northwest Florida and south Alabama. The organization includes three hospitals, four medical parks, Andrews Institute for Orthopaedic & Sports Medicine, and an extensive primary and specialty care provider network. With more than 4,000 team members, Baptist Health Care is one of the largest non-governmental employers in northwest Florida. Baptist Health Care, Inc. is an Equal Opportunity Employer.
